Set the region

Along with the language setting, the region setting determines the default date format.

Use to choose the region you want, then press

.

Set the date and time

Accurately setting the date and time will help you locate images once you have transferred them to your computer, and will ensure that images are accurately marked if you use the date and time imprint feature. See Date & Time Imprint under Using the Picture Capture and Video Record menus” on page 14.

1.Use to adjust the highlighted value.

2.Use to move to the other selections and repeat Step 1 until the date and time are set correctly.

3.Press when the date, time, and format

settings are correct, then press again to confirm.

To change the date and time later, use the Camera

Setup Menu (see Using the Camera Setup Menu” on page 33).
